Dear Asrock Team,

i found several issues in latest Fatal1ty AB350 Gaming-ITX/ac BIOS 4.50 with Ryzen 7 1800x.
The following functions are not working:
1. "CSM disable" or "Fast boot enabled" will cause "no screen" issue and need to use CLR CMOS Jumper to bring the board back to work. Looks like CSM need to be always "enabled" and means legacy + UEFI mode only and no "pure" UEFI mode!
2. Since BIOS 4.50 "no SATA / PCIe SSD / HDD / ODD" will be detected in the Storage configuration page > no device shown!

Configuration:
Fatal1ty AB350 Gaming-ITX/ac with BIOS 4.50
Ryzen 7 1800x
Hyper X 2666MHz 2x 8GB Memory
GTX1080 8GB Founders Edition
PCIe SSD 512GB Samsung PM961
WD 4TB HDD
Bequiet PSU 750W
